5.1-magnitude quake hits waters off Taiwan: CENC
Share - WeChat

BEIJING -- A 5.1-magnitude earthquake jolted the waters off southern Taiwan's Pingdong county at 9:47 pm Monday Beijing Time, according to the China Earthquake Networks Center (CENC).
The epicenter was monitored at 21.62 degrees north latitude and 120.97 degrees east longitude, at a depth of 18 km, the CENC said.
